Key Considerations for Semaglutide Use With Blood Thinners

07 April 2026 | Tuesday | News


Semaglutide has become an important medication in the management of type 2 diabetes and, more recently, in weight management for certain patients. It belongs to a class of drugs known as glucagon-like peptide-1 (GLP-1) receptor agonists, which help regulate blood sugar levels by improving insulin secretion, slowing gastric emptying, and reducing appetite.

At the same time, many individuals who may benefit from semaglutide are also taking anticoagulant or antiplatelet medications, commonly referred to as blood thinners. These drugs are prescribed to reduce the risk of blood clots, stroke, or heart attack. Because both medication types influence different physiological systems, careful consideration is necessary when they are used together.

Healthcare providers often evaluate possible interactions, patient health status, and monitoring needs before recommending this combination. Guidance from medical centers and clinical research organizations highlights the importance of individualized assessment and ongoing communication between patients and healthcare professionals.

Understanding How Semaglutide Works

Semaglutide functions by mimicking the action of the natural hormone GLP-1. This hormone plays several roles in glucose metabolism and digestion. When semaglutide activates GLP-1 receptors, it stimulates insulin release in response to elevated blood sugar while reducing the amount of glucagon produced by the liver. The result is improved blood glucose control.

Another significant effect of semaglutide is delayed gastric emptying. Food moves more slowly from the stomach to the small intestine, which can help reduce spikes in blood sugar after meals. This mechanism also contributes to feelings of fullness, which can lead to reduced calorie intake and gradual weight loss in some individuals.

Although these effects are beneficial for many patients, the slowed digestive process may influence how other medications are absorbed. For individuals taking blood thinners, changes in medication absorption or dietary habits may indirectly affect anticoagulation management.

The Role of Blood Thinners in Medical Treatment

Blood thinners are prescribed to prevent dangerous clot formation in people with conditions such as atrial fibrillation, deep vein thrombosis, pulmonary embolism, or certain cardiovascular diseases. These medications work through different mechanisms depending on the type.

Anticoagulants such as warfarin, direct oral anticoagulants (DOACs), and injectable agents reduce the ability of blood to clot by interfering with clotting factors in the bloodstream. Antiplatelet medications, including aspirin or clopidogrel, work by preventing platelets from sticking together during the early stages of clot formation.

Because these medications influence the body's natural clotting processes, maintaining stable and predictable dosing is important. Even small changes in metabolism, nutrition, or medication absorption can alter how effectively the therapy works. This is why healthcare professionals carefully monitor patients taking anticoagulants, especially when new medications are introduced.

Potential Interactions Between Semaglutide and Blood Thinners

Currently, semaglutide is not widely recognized as having a direct pharmacological interaction with most blood thinners. Still, several indirect factors may require attention when both treatments are used.

One consideration involves gastrointestinal effects. Semaglutide can cause nausea, vomiting, or reduced appetite, particularly during the early stages of treatment. If these symptoms lead to reduced food intake or inconsistent nutrition, they may affect medications such as warfarin that depend partly on dietary vitamin K balance. Changes in vitamin K intake can alter anticoagulant effectiveness.

Another factor relates to delayed gastric emptying. Because semaglutide slows digestion, oral medications may sometimes take longer to be absorbed into the bloodstream. While this effect does not necessarily reduce the effectiveness of blood thinners, it may influence the timing or consistency of drug absorption in certain individuals.

Weight loss associated with semaglutide use can also influence medication requirements. As body weight and metabolic health change, physicians may reassess dosages for several medications, including anticoagulants.

Monitoring and Medical Supervision

Close medical supervision is important when semaglutide is introduced to a treatment plan that already includes blood thinners. Monitoring helps ensure that both therapies continue to work safely and effectively.

For patients taking warfarin, physicians typically rely on laboratory tests known as the International Normalized Ratio (INR). This test measures how long it takes blood to clot and helps determine whether anticoagulation levels remain within a safe range. When new medications are added or when diet and weight change significantly, INR testing may be performed more frequently.

Patients using direct oral anticoagulants may not require routine laboratory monitoring in the same way, but clinicians still evaluate symptoms, medication adherence, and possible side effects. Regular follow-up appointments help identify any changes that may affect treatment outcomes.

Healthcare teams may also assess other factors such as kidney function, liver function, and cardiovascular health. These evaluations ensure that medications remain appropriate as a patient’s health status evolves.

Lifestyle and Dietary Considerations

Lifestyle habits play a meaningful role in managing both diabetes medications and anticoagulant therapy. Semaglutide may reduce appetite and encourage dietary changes, which can be beneficial for metabolic health. However, consistent nutrition remains important, particularly for individuals whose anticoagulation therapy is sensitive to vitamin K intake.

Leafy green vegetables, for example, contain high levels of vitamin K. These foods are nutritious and generally encouraged in a balanced diet, but sudden increases or decreases in consumption may affect certain anticoagulants. Patients are typically advised to maintain a stable pattern of dietary intake rather than eliminating these foods entirely.

Hydration, physical activity, and overall health management are also important. Regular exercise can support cardiovascular health and glucose regulation, while adequate hydration supports normal circulation and metabolic processes. Any significant lifestyle changes should be discussed with a healthcare professional to ensure they align with ongoing treatment.

Communication Between Patients and Healthcare Providers

Effective communication between patients and healthcare providers is one of the most important elements of safe medication management. Individuals using semaglutide alongside blood thinners should inform their medical team about all medications they take, including over-the-counter products and supplements.

Some supplements and herbal products may affect blood clotting or interact with anticoagulants. Examples include vitamin E, fish oil, or certain herbal preparations. Even though these products may seem harmless, they can influence bleeding risk when combined with blood-thinning medications.

Patients should also report symptoms such as unusual bruising, prolonged bleeding, severe nausea, or persistent gastrointestinal discomfort. Early reporting allows healthcare providers to evaluate whether medication adjustments or additional monitoring may be needed.

Conclusion

Using semaglutide while taking blood thinners requires thoughtful consideration and medical supervision. Semaglutide improves glucose regulation, slows gastric emptying, and influences appetite, while blood thinners reduce the risk of clot formation through different mechanisms.

Indirect factors such as digestive changes, dietary shifts, weight loss, and medication absorption may influence anticoagulation management when these treatments are used together. Careful monitoring, including laboratory testing for certain anticoagulants, helps maintain safe treatment levels.

Stable nutrition, healthy lifestyle habits, and regular medical follow-ups support positive health outcomes. Clear communication between patients and healthcare professionals remains the most effective way to identify potential issues early and maintain safe use of both therapies.
